chaps. using an RC18T last night suddenly had the wheels turn inwards to the right and the throttle not being at neutral, as though the settings had jumped from 50/50 to 70/30...I was running the car at the time and did not think this was an adjustment I could accidently make. tried rebinding and even a new model but no change
Trying on a different car this morning and the same thing has happened. I have an old module so I swapped and rebound and hey presto it works....is the module knacked, or is there something glaryingly obvious that I have missed? ![]() |

Hi,
if its the grey module you may have a problem with the way that the antenna wire is routed inside the module. This can cause interferance problems, I had the same thing hapen with mine, I contacted Spektrum sent in my module they sorted it out I have been using it ever since without problems.
